Terry Richardson is an American photographer, known for his provocative style of photography. He was born 1965 in New York City, raised in Hollywood, California, and is the son of fashion photographer Bob Richardson. Terry began photographing his environment while attending Hollywood High School and playing in a punk rock band. He has shot advertisements for fashion designers, including Gucci, Levi's, Hugo Boss, Anna Molinari, Baby Phat, Matsuda, and Sisley. Richardson has also shot editorial photographs for a Vogue, Vice, Harpers Bazaar, The Face, GQ and Sports Illustrated.
Richardson's photobooks include Hysteric Glamour (1998), Son of Bob (1999), Feared by Men Desired by Women (2000), Too Much (2001), Terryworld and Kibosh.
